Roy Halston Frowick (April 23, 1932 – March 26, 1990), who was known mononymously as Halston, was an American fashion designer, and he rose to international fame in the 1970s. Halston (born April 23, 1932, Des Moines, Iowa, U.S.—died March 26, 1990, San Francisco, California) was an American designer of elegant fashions with a streamlined look. He was widely considered the first superstar designer in the United States , and his clothing defined 1970s American fashion.
